    Superfan - Game Mix, Red Zone

    With an HR10-250, you can watch the Game Mix channels, but you can't change the audio from game to game. You're stuck with whatever the default is. The Red Zone channel works fine, since it switches by itself.

    DirecTV to offer free HD receiver upgrade

    HD Locals will be on the two new Spaceway satellites at 99 and 103. This will require a new dish, rumored to be 5 LNB.

    MPEG4 and PQ

    IIRC, the next NFL broadcast contract, which starts next season, requires all games to be broadcast in HD. The new set of contracts also shifts Monday Night Football to ESPN and Sunday Night Football to NBC.

    H/D Sunday tck channel sked on D*

    CBS typically shows AFC teams and they only have 3 HD production teams, so can only show 3 HD games a week. Your local affiliate may upconvert the feed so it will appear to be HD (16:9 format, DD5.1 flag), but they may just show whatever they get from CBS.
